Output e3d866ecf7a52911fb777a5ab905999bd4f63bc0b0625e397c2622fb562643ca:5
- value
- 967354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b598c1b8e561c58f83aff3090ea28af7d971d700 OP_EQUAL
- address
- 3JFDDzHmdUtSKDBYKEK4TfvTvMcpMpLHAr
- transaction
- e3d866ecf7a52911fb777a5ab905999bd4f63bc0b0625e397c2622fb562643ca